Senatobia lost against New Albany back in January and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. The Senatobia Warriors fell just short of the New Albany Bulldogs by a score of 66-64. Despite running the score up even higher than they did in their prior game last Saturday (61), the Warriors still had to take the loss.

It was another big night for Issac Gilbert, who dropped a double-double on 15 points and 14 rebounds for New Albany. Gilbert continues to improve, besting his previous point total in each of the last three games he's played. The team also got some help courtesy of Amari Hubbard, who went 5 of 9 on his way to 13 points.

Senatobia's defeat dropped their record down to 8-3. As for New Albany, the win was the third in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 5-3.

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Senatobia will welcome South Pontotoc at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. New Albany will take on Pontotoc in a holiday battle at at 7:00 p.m. on Monday. The timing is sure in New Albany's favor as the team sits on four straight wins at home while Pontotoc has been banged up by three consecutive losses on the road.
